Output 96e68f645b3efda500926e5668f8c3c8decabee97f4131cfe016c388799ab3cd:18

value
321767564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eebacbd9b1f384a4393e3306f4cb8f4cf211d768 OP_EQUAL
address
3PTJX2suyeicdCiAkEA1jCPHdg1W4rUQUE
transaction
96e68f645b3efda500926e5668f8c3c8decabee97f4131cfe016c388799ab3cd
spent
true